Luxor International Airport will begin welcoming direct flights from London Gatwick Airport, operated by EasyJet, one of the United Kingdom’s (UK) largest budget airlines. The flights will run twice weekly, every Monday and Thursday, starting 1 November.. Mohamed Hassan, a member of the Luxor Chamber of Travel and Tourism Companies, told Al Masry Al Youm that this initiative is “exciting”, as it comes after nearly a decade-long hiatus to the London-Luxor route. To attract more tourists to the route, a new advertising campaign was launched in London, featuring individuals dressed as the ancient Egyptian god Anubis, promoting the different attractions of Luxor.
